Mimaki stretches its portfolio with new ink

Mimaki has moved to expand its selection of inks with the addition of a new stretchable product suitable for a host of thermoforming applications

Mimaki LUS-350 ink is compatible with the firm’s UJF-7151plus and JFX200-2513 models

Mimaki LUS-350, which will stretch up to 350 percent when heated to between 120 and 200°C, is compatible with the manufacturer’s UJF-7151plus and JFX200-2513 printers.

After cooling to room temperature, Mimaki says the ink's rigidity is restored, while adhering to the moulded product without cracking or peeling.

The manufacturer also added that the new LUS-350 clear ink is unique in the market as it has the ability to add texture or a glossy finish that cannot be achieved with coloured ink alone.

Stuart Cole, national sales manager for industrial products Hybrid Services, the exclusive distributor of Mimaki kit in the UK and Ireland, has welcomed the new ink, describing the launch as exciting for the manufacturer’s customer base.

“This is a very exciting development for Mimaki users in the industrial sector who need to produce items with greater creativity in a less time consuming manner and more cost effectively than previously. Yet again forward thinking technological development from Mimaki will provide end users with greater flexibility and the potential to create and develop an ever wider range of bespoke products.”

Mimaki is already known across the industry for its wide range of inks and this new launch will only attract further interest in its product portfolio.
